Garden Maintenance Service in Ventura County, CA
Garden maintenance services encompass a range of tasks aimed at keeping outdoor spaces healthy, attractive, and well-kept. These services typically include lawn mowing, trimming shrubs and hedges, pruning trees, weed control, edging, and seasonal clean-up. Property owners often request garden maintenance to ensure their yards remain tidy, lush, and inviting, whether for everyday enjoyment or special occasions. Before requesting these services, homeowners usually want to understand what specific tasks are included, how often the work will be performed, and what preparations they might need to make to facilitate the maintenance process.
Understanding the scope of garden maintenance projects is essential for property owners considering these services. Common projects include maintaining flower beds, removing debris, aerating lawns, and applying fertilizers or treatments to promote healthy growth. It’s helpful to clarify if services cover both routine upkeep and seasonal adjustments, as well as any additional landscaping or planting needs. Property owners should also inquire about the equipment used and whether any specific instructions or restrictions apply to their outdoor spaces to ensure the maintenance aligns with their expectations and property requirements.

Common Garden Maintenance Service Jobs
Lawn Care - regular mowing, edging, and fertilization to keep lawns healthy and tidy.
Garden Bed Maintenance - weeding, mulching, and trimming to promote plant growth and aesthetics.
Tree and Shrub Trimming - shaping and pruning to ensure safety and healthy development.
Leaf and Debris Removal - clearing fallen leaves and debris to maintain a clean landscape.
Seasonal Cleanup - preparing gardens for different seasons with pruning, trimming, and debris removal.
Irrigation System Maintenance - inspecting and repairing sprinklers to ensure efficient watering.
Garden Maintenance Service Questions
What types of garden maintenance services are available? Services include lawn mowing, trimming, pruning, weed control, and seasonal cleanup to keep gardens healthy and attractive.
How often should garden maintenance be performed? Frequency depends on the garden’s size and plant types, with common options including we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ly visits.
What equipment is used during garden maintenance? Professional tools such as lawnmowers, hedge trimmers, pruning shears, and blowers are typically used to ensure quality results.
Can garden maintenance help improve plant health? Yes, regular care promotes healthy growth, prevents pests, and maintains the overall appearance of the landscape.
